How does Wilsey, KS compare to McDonald, KS? Wilsey has a population of 192 with a median household income of $58,333, while McDonald has 190 residents and a median income of $88,171.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Wilsey, KS | McDonald, KS |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 192 | 190 | +1.1% |
| Median Age | 46.3 | 69 | -32.9% |
| Foreign Born % | 5.2% | 14.2% | -63.4% |
